Organic Insect Control Representatives
Integrating biological pest control agents right into pest administration approaches provides a sustainable and eco-friendly strategy to managing insect populaces. Organic control includes using all-natural enemies, such as predators, parasites, and microorganisms, to suppress insect populaces. These agents particularly target bugs, minimizing the need for broad-spectrum go now chemical pesticides that can have dangerous impacts on non-target microorganisms and the atmosphere.
One efficient biological control agent is the usage of parasitoids, which lay agitate or inside bug insects, ultimately eliminating them. Ladybugs, lacewings, and predacious termites are examples of killers that eat pests like aphids and crawler termites. Entomopathogenic fungis and microorganisms are used to contaminate and kill insect pests without harming advantageous organisms.
Ultrasonic Insect Deterrent Instruments
Just how reliable are ultrasonic parasite deterrent gadgets in controlling parasite populaces? Ultrasonic parasite deterrent tools are electronic gadgets made to emit high-frequency sound waves that are thought to repel pests such as rodents and pests. Supporters of these gadgets declare that the sent out ultrasonic waves interfere with bugs' interaction, feeding, and reproductive patterns, driving them away from the area where the tool is mounted.
Nonetheless, the performance of ultrasonic parasite deterrent tools is a topic of discussion amongst professionals. While some research studies suggest that these devices can have a short-term influence on parasite actions, others argue that pests can swiftly become accustomed to the acoustic waves or find means to adjust to them. Additionally, the efficiency of these gadgets can vary depending upon variables such as the kind of pest, the layout of the room, and the top quality their explanation of the gadget being utilized.
